SERTICH REELECTED MAJORITY LEADER
Friday, November 14th, 2008
Representative Tony Sertich (DFL-Chisholm) was reelected by his colleagues to be the Minnesota House Majority Leader for the upcoming legislative session.
Sertich was elected House Majority Leader in 2006 when Democrats gained a majority of seats in the Minnesota House. At the time, he was the youngest Majority Leader in Minnesota’s history. He is also the highest ranking legislator from Greater Minnesota.
“It is truly an honor to serve the state in this capacity. My first priority and highest commitment remains to the people back home - the citizens that elected me to represent their interests at the capital. Fortunately, this position gives our area a little higher profile, someone in leadership to provide our perspective,” Sertich said.
The Majority Leader is the second highest ranking official in the Minnesota House of Representatives. He chairs the Rules and Administration Committee, is responsible for the internal House budget, and schedules legislation on the House calendar. The Leader fills the role of floor leader during House floor debate and is a key leader in gauging support among members for legislation.
Sertich was reelected to the House of Representatives on Tuesday. Originally elected in 2000, he will be serving his fifth term.
